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
  • 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:ExcelのVBAのエラーについて)

ExcelのVBAのエラーについて

このQ&Aのポイント
  • VBA初心者がファイルの選択画面でキャンセルを押すとエラー1004が出る問題に対して、解決策を探しています。
  • VBAの実装図読み込みボタンでファイルを選択しようとすると「ファイルが選択されませんでした」というエラーメッセージが出ます。エラーを回避する方法を教えてください。
  • ExcelのVBAで実装図を読み込むためのボタンを作成しましたが、ファイル選択画面でキャンセルを押すとエラー1004が発生します。解決方法を教えてください。

質問者が選んだベストアンサー

  • ベストアンサー
  • kmetu
  • ベストアンサー率41% (562/1346)
回答No.1

If vriFileName = Falese Then MsgBox "ファイルが選択されませんでした。", _ vbOKOnly + vbExcelamation, "ファイル名の入力チェック" Exit Sub End If というように Exit Sub を入れてみてください。 ファイルを選択していない状態でファイルを開くところまで進んでいますから ファイル名が不正なファイルを開こうとしてエラーになっています。

すると、全ての回答が全文表示されます。

その他の回答 (1)

  • kmetu
  • ベストアンサー率41% (562/1346)
回答No.2

もしくは If vriFileName = Falese Then MsgBox "ファイルが選択されませんでした。", _ vbOKOnly + vbExcelamation, "ファイル名の入力チェック" Else Set targetBook = Workbooks.Open(vriFileName) 中略 Set newWorksheet = Nothing End If にしてください。

ken_6
質問者

お礼

kmetuさん、素早いかつ確実なご回答どうもありがとうございます。 おかげさまでうまく実行できました。 ネットと本を参考に初めてVBAを使用して今回作成しているのでいざという時に応用が利かなくて困ってましたが大変助かりました。

すると、全ての回答が全文表示されます。

関連するQ&A